titleOfInvention | Antimicrobial dyes using fluoroquinolone-based antibiotic pre-stage materials as diazos and methods for their preparation and antimicrobial fibers using the same |
abstract | The present invention relates to an azo-based antimicrobial dye having a structure in which a dye intermediate and a chromophore are bonded to a previous stage material of a fluoroquinolone antibiotic as a powerful antimicrobial reactor, and a method for preparing the same.n n n The antimicrobial dye compound of the present invention is capable of producing various types of dyes by applying a variety of chromophores, and dyeing the fibers using the same, exhibits strong antimicrobial properties, thereby inhibiting the growth or proliferation of microorganisms, preventing infectious diseases, preventing odors, Functional antimicrobial fiber products can be produced that can prevent fiber contamination and embrittlement.n n n Antibacterial dyes, azo-based, lomeflosacine, fluoroquinoline antibiotics, antibacterial fibers. |
